Care Tip | Details |
---|---|
☀️ Light | Bright, indirect light. Avoid harsh direct sunlight which can burn the delicate leaves. |
💧 Water | Water when the top 2 inches of soil are dry. Prefers consistent moisture but not soggy roots. |
🌡 Temperature | 65°F to 80°F. Avoid exposure below 55°F. |
🧴 Fertilizer | Use a balanced liquid fertilizer (like 20-20-20) monthly during spring and summer; reduce feeding in fall and winter |
🪴 Potting Mix | Well-draining aroid mix — 40% chunky perlite, 30% orchid bark, 20% peat moss, 10% worm castings |

🎤 Botanical Bio
The Philodendron tortum is a rare and eye-catching aroid known for its deeply lobed, skeletal-like leaves. Native to the rainforests of Brazil, it brings a tropical, architectural touch to indoor plant collections. Its fast-growing, vining nature makes it perfect for training on a moss pole or letting trail freely.
